原文:TypeScript Type Innference(類型推斷)

在這一節,我們將介紹TypeScript中的類型推斷。我們將會討論類型推斷需要在何處用到以及如何推斷。 基礎 在TypeScript中,在幾個沒有明確指定類型注釋的地方將會使用類型推斷來提供類型信息。 變量 x 的值被推斷為number。這種推斷發生在變量或者成員初始化 設置參數默認值 決定函數返回類型的時候。 最佳公共類型 當需要從多個表達式中進行類型推斷的時候,這些表達式的類型將會用來推斷出一 ...

2016-03-09 16:37 2 1329 推薦指數:

查看詳情

TypeScript類型注釋和類型推斷

文檔:05TS類型注釋和類型推斷.md 鏈接:http://note.youdao.com/noteshare?id=337239dc53b2b1311445c4b10cbcd341&sub=89342866B9914BB3A1E2E22C51D229B2 ...

Fri Nov 13 00:46:00 CST 2020 0 504
TypeScript 類型注解、類型推斷類型斷言

一、類型注解(Type annotation) 所謂類型注解,就是人為為一個變量指定類型,例如: 在 vscode 中鼠標移入 a 出現提示,冒號后面就是類型注解: 當不添加類型注解時,TypesScript 也能知道變量 a 是一個數字,這就是 TypeScript ...

Thu Jul 23 06:17:00 CST 2020 0 1354
TypeScript Type Compatibility(類型兼容)

TypeScript中的類型兼容是基於結構歸類的。在普通分類的相比之下,結構歸類是一種純粹用於將其成員的類型進行關聯的方法。思考下面的代碼: 如C#、Java這些表面上的類型語言(這里指的“表面上的類型語言”,指C#和Java需要使用“implements”關鍵字明確指出類實現 ...

Tue Mar 15 06:34:00 CST 2016 0 2320
現代C++之理解模板類型推斷(template type deduction)

理解模板類型推斷(template type deduction) 我們往往不能理解一個復雜的系統是如何運作的,但是卻知道這個系統能夠做什么。C++的模板類型推斷便是如此,把參數傳遞到模板函數往往能讓程序員得到滿意的結果,但是卻不能夠比較清晰的描述其中的推斷過程。模板類型推斷是現代C++中被廣泛 ...

Thu Mar 21 02:36:00 CST 2019 0 1456
 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M